summaryrefslogtreecommitdiffstats
path: root/src/com/android/gallery3d/app
diff options
context:
space:
mode:
Diffstat (limited to 'src/com/android/gallery3d/app')
-rw-r--r--src/com/android/gallery3d/app/AlbumDataLoader.java2
-rw-r--r--src/com/android/gallery3d/app/AlbumSetDataLoader.java4
-rw-r--r--src/com/android/gallery3d/app/PhotoDataAdapter.java2
-rw-r--r--src/com/android/gallery3d/app/SlideshowPage.java4
4 files changed, 6 insertions, 6 deletions
diff --git a/src/com/android/gallery3d/app/AlbumDataLoader.java b/src/com/android/gallery3d/app/AlbumDataLoader.java
index 28a822830..77fd0db8a 100644
--- a/src/com/android/gallery3d/app/AlbumDataLoader.java
+++ b/src/com/android/gallery3d/app/AlbumDataLoader.java
@@ -368,7 +368,7 @@ public class AlbumDataLoader {
mDirty = false;
}
updateLoading(true);
- long version = mSource.reload();
+ long version = mSource.loadIfDirty();
UpdateInfo info = executeAndWait(new GetUpdateInfo(version));
updateComplete = info == null;
if (updateComplete) continue;
diff --git a/src/com/android/gallery3d/app/AlbumSetDataLoader.java b/src/com/android/gallery3d/app/AlbumSetDataLoader.java
index cf380f812..8c73d4ef5 100644
--- a/src/com/android/gallery3d/app/AlbumSetDataLoader.java
+++ b/src/com/android/gallery3d/app/AlbumSetDataLoader.java
@@ -343,7 +343,7 @@ public class AlbumSetDataLoader {
while (mActive) {
synchronized (this) {
if (mActive && !mDirty && updateComplete) {
- if (!mSource.isLoading()) updateLoading(false);
+ updateLoading(false);
Utils.waitWithoutInterrupt(this);
continue;
}
@@ -351,7 +351,7 @@ public class AlbumSetDataLoader {
mDirty = false;
updateLoading(true);
- long version = mSource.reload();
+ long version = mSource.loadIfDirty();
UpdateInfo info = executeAndWait(new GetUpdateInfo(version));
updateComplete = info == null;
if (updateComplete) continue;
diff --git a/src/com/android/gallery3d/app/PhotoDataAdapter.java b/src/com/android/gallery3d/app/PhotoDataAdapter.java
index 2b586da94..faff14674 100644
--- a/src/com/android/gallery3d/app/PhotoDataAdapter.java
+++ b/src/com/android/gallery3d/app/PhotoDataAdapter.java
@@ -1033,7 +1033,7 @@ public class PhotoDataAdapter implements PhotoPage.Model {
mDirty = false;
UpdateInfo info = executeAndWait(new GetUpdateInfo());
updateLoading(true);
- long version = mSource.reload();
+ long version = mSource.loadIfDirty();
if (info.version != version) {
info.reloadContent = true;
info.size = mSource.getMediaItemCount();
diff --git a/src/com/android/gallery3d/app/SlideshowPage.java b/src/com/android/gallery3d/app/SlideshowPage.java
index 54aae67ab..51bc70feb 100644
--- a/src/com/android/gallery3d/app/SlideshowPage.java
+++ b/src/com/android/gallery3d/app/SlideshowPage.java
@@ -272,7 +272,7 @@ public class SlideshowPage extends ActivityState {
@Override
public long reload() {
- long version = mMediaSet.reload();
+ long version = mMediaSet.loadIfDirty();
if (version != mSourceVersion) {
mSourceVersion = version;
int count = mMediaSet.getTotalMediaItemCount();
@@ -346,7 +346,7 @@ public class SlideshowPage extends ActivityState {
@Override
public long reload() {
- long version = mMediaSet.reload();
+ long version = mMediaSet.loadIfDirty();
if (version != mDataVersion) {
mDataVersion = version;
mData.clear();